UK BOARDING SCHOOLS BRING GLOBAL CLASSROOM TO ABUJA, LAGOS

Thinking of a British boarding education? Top UK schools are coming to Nigeria to meet families face-to-face.

Leading UK boarding schools are set to meet Nigerian parents and students this March as part of UK Boarding Schools Week 2026, with exhibitions in Abuja and Lagos.

Organised by Mark Brooks Education, the events will give families a rare chance to interact directly with school heads, learn about admissions, and explore academic and co-curricular opportunities in the British boarding system.

According to organiser Mark Brooks, a UK trade export champion, the programme is designed to help families understand the academic pathways, pastoral care and international learning environment offered by top UK schools.

The Abuja exhibition holds on March 4 at the Transcorp Hilton, while Lagos hosts its session on March 7 at The George Hotel, Ikoyi. Some schools will also offer private meetings and a follow-up session on March 8.

Participating schools include Bromsgrove School, Wellington School, Cardiff Sixth Form College, Canford School, Lancing College, Downside School, and others—many of which already host Nigerian and West African students.

Attendance is free, though families are encouraged to register in advance.
